Applications of Organic and Biological Chemistry
Understanding organic and biological chemistry has far-reaching implications in various fields. Some key applications include:
- Medicine: Knowledge of biochemical processes is essential for drug development and understanding disease mechanisms.
- Environmental Science: Organic chemistry plays a crucial role in studying pollutants and developing sustainable solutions.
- Agriculture: The chemistry of fertilizers and pesticides is vital for improving crop yields and managing pests.
- Food Science: Understanding the chemical composition of food can lead to improved preservation methods and nutritional content.
